    A tip: if you get an old tire and put the logs you're splitting in the center, it'll hold the chunks upright as you split and remove the need for picking up the individual pieces for further splitting. Pack it tight and the natural combination of slight elasticity and steel cords will keep the pieces together... Came across that a while back and it's made the process of chunking through the firewood stack next to the house much easier. There's a certain satisfaction to spending a day logsplitting - the timber keeps you warm three times, once when you cut it, once when you split it, and a third when you finally get around to burning it!
